What is an Abstract of Title and Other Maritime Registration Questions
An abstract of title refers to the record of all documents that have been submitted to the United States Coast Guard for one particular vessel. The Role of the MARAD Waiver in Placing Foreign Ships in the US
The Maritime Administration grants ships manufactured in other countries a specific concession known as the MARAD waiver. Occasionally, these ships can transport goods from one port to the next.
